Intro to variables, algebraic expressions, and equations

Evaluating Algebraic expressions

Variables: a letter that represents a number

Algebraic expression/ just expression: a combination of operations on variables and numbers

if two variables or a number and variable are next to each other, with no operation sign between them, the operation is multiplication

Ex:

2x=2\cdot x

Evaluating the expression: is replacing a variable in an expression by a number and then finding the value of the expression
